]]>For example, in the 18th century, it wasn’t uncommon to rent a pineapple in order to impress party guests. This was because pineapples were considered a luxury and the price of one went up to today’s $8,000 at some point.
Celery wasn’t as expensive, but it definitely had a moment in history. The Victorian era people used to keep it in special glass vases and display at visible places. Celery dishes were considered a delicacy and they were the main thing at every dinner party. Whenever you’re not feeling like eating celery, remember that the first-class guests on Titanic had it as an exclusive treat.

]]>Sobrino de Botín is located in the capital of Spain where it has been standing since 1725. According to the Guinness World Records, this is the oldest restaurant in the world. It was initially called Casa Botín and got its current name from the second owner.
Serving customers since 1826, Union Oyster House is located in Boston and is considered the oldest working restaurant in the U.S.
